Shall I count the ways?
1) Anaesthesia... I have this almost-not-quite-phobia about not having the anesthesia take effect on my conscious mind. In other words, paralysis, but feeling still intact. Rare, but it happens.
2) Anaesthesia #2... I'm a redhead. Redheads, in general, need more anaesthesia. No longer just anecdote, it's become accepted fact in medical communities. (The weird thing is that we have a lower pain *threshhold*, but a higher pain *tolerance*, in general. So we're tough as nails, we just bitch more about it. :) ) More anaesthesia is riskier.
3) Nerve damage... I'd hate to wake up with no use of the arm. If I sleep on my right side now, the shoulder slides out of place and presses on a nerve to my hand, and it goes to sleep.
4) Infection... becoming more and more of a problem. While I have a really good immune system in general, necrosis is not my friend.
